On International Women’s Day, a grave insulting incident has occurred in Vizianagaram district and it involved former union minister Ashok Gajapathi Raju. While campaigning for the municipal elections in the district, a woman threw petals of flowers on the TDP leader.
However, the petals fell on Ashok’s eyes causing discomfort for him. Angered by this Ashok Gajapathi Raju slapped the woman and all this happened in public. Local leaders and cadres who were with Ashok Gajapathi Raju were shocked by the act.
The TDP leader claimed that the woman deliberately threw flowers at his eyes. The woman TDP Karyakatha is yet to be identified. Surprisingly, no leader did utter a word on seeing this incident and for a brief moment, there was a pin drop silence. Later the TDP campaign went ahead led by Ashok Gajapathi Raju.
